My name is Jaskaran, and I am nominating myself for the position of vice president. My journey with Bhangra, from performances at weddings to being on stage at Rangeela, has been truly amazing. The more I delve into Bhangra, the more thrilling it becomes. Reflecting on my initial encounter with Bhangra at UCL, I was captivated by the skills of the senior dancers and met many people who are now great friends. I hope to spark the same enthusiasm and welcomeness I first felt at the start to the future members.

As a candidate for vice president, my vision is to share the joy and excitement I receive from Bhangra with others, creating a society where individuals from diverse backgrounds can freely express themselves through Bhangra regardless of their experience.

My agenda contains a lineup of events, including weekly classes with creative choreography, social gatherings, and collaborations with other universities. I aim to create an environment where the society thrives with organization and teamwork, while ensuring inclusivity for all members and representatives.

With your support, I aspire to push the boundaries and propel UCL Bhangra to new heights, both in the social media realm and within the university. As a final aspiration, I am determined to be a supportive leader to everyone and set an example that people can look up to, while being confident in myself to uphold high standards for the society.

My name is Aman and I am also running to be your Vice President!

Bhangra has been both the most fun yet challenging experiences at university so far. I cherish every moment with my society and friends at Bhangra whether it be performing, training, taking classes or our socials and I want more people to be able to experience how wonderful Bhangra is here at UCL.

That brings me to what I want to do as president for Bhangra society, namely make UCL Bhangra more inclusive and use my platform to uplift and empower others to be proud of and engage in traditional Punjabi culture. Some of the steps I want to take include:

  • More regular classes that empower our members to learn and teach Bhangra
  • Engagement with our marketing team to grow our online presence on social media 
  • More inter-society collabs
  •  Increase engagement in classes through feedback forums 
  • Regular socials e.g games and movie nights, dinners, bowlings etc

I know I have the right qualities to be able to lead UCL Bhangra strongly into the new year because I don’t shy away from responsibility and I am proud to showcase the culture, talent and community we have within our society. As someone who is proactive and approachable, I know I can work with our new committee to make our community even bigger and welcome everyone.
